If you're building a new house or doing a substantial renovation, be sure to put in proper physical or chemical barriers. A few can be retrofitted but it's simpler to install them during construction.

Termite shields (also known as ant caps) don't prevent termite activity but bring it into the open, since it is easier to detect their mud shelter tubes on the metal caps.

Woven stainless steel mesh or finely graded stone particles can be installed in a concrete slab and cavity walls around pipe openings and so on, so termites can't get through these concealed entry points.

Composite systems like treated plastic or fabric sheets contain chemicals that'll degrade over time, unlike true physical obstacles.

Reticulation methods involve piping fitted under slabs and around the borders of a building with access points for injection of insecticide.

Chemical barriers are employed under and around a concrete slab or around the building piers or footings.

Synthetic pyrethroids such as permethrin or bifenthrin are generally less toxic than many of the prior insecticides which were banned in most areas of Australia in the mid 1990s.

Fipronil and imidacloprid are particularly effective against termites since they are non-repellant. This means the termites will travel throughout the zone without detecting the chemical and return into the colony, therefore contaminating other termites.

Arsenic trioxide dust is a really poisonous substance and a confirmed carcinogen for humans. It was commonly utilized in the past in termite dusting procedures but has been replaced with less poisonous insect growth regulators (IGRs) such as triflumuron. This is a less toxic but more costly alternative that will require routine maintenance. Monitoring and bait stations use very small amounts of a low-toxic IGR that affects the termite's exoskeleton and kills them without harming other animals or humans.

The insect manager places a baiting station (or many ) in the vicinity of the home, usually in-ground.

The station is assessed frequently, repositioned if needed and when termites are found, bait is added to replenish the station.

The kittens accept the bait back to their nest and disperse it through grooming, till the colony has been eventually wiped out.

There's no guarantee the termites will actually find the lure, so it's generally not a good idea to use a monitoring and bait station as the only approach to termite management.

Phone several pest managers before committing to one you're unlikely to get detailed information or a particular cost over the phone, however you ought to be able to get a general impression about the company, their termite treatment and a range of prices you can anticipate.

Compare the options, quotations and professionalism of the a variety of pest managers and decide on the company that you're most comfortable with.

Can they meet, or exceed, the requirements of the Australian Standard (AS4349.3 provides guidelines for inspecting buildings for wood pests; AS3660.2 deals with termite management in and around existing buildings and structures).

Just how long will the inspection take (An ordinary home should take two to three hours to inspect, including the period that the inspector spends discussing the problems with you.)
